What is the Wolf Moon?

The January full moon earns this name due to the increased activity of wolves during this season, according to the Old Farmer's Almanac. Wolfs are so interesting to me. Their howls echoing on cold nights. The origin of the name lies in the Sioux language, where it is described as the "wolves run together" moon.
